About the Job

We are seeking a results-driven Account Manager to lead customer retention and revenue growth across a portfolio of restaurant partners in the Las Vegas metro area. Reporting to the Manager of Account Management, this field-based role serves as a trusted advisor to local restaurant operators by delivering data-driven insights and optimizing reservation workflows. In this position, you will proactively engage with leadership to overcome operational challenges, champion customer needs cross-functionally, and expand adoption of premium marketing solutions. The ideal candidate brings a collaborative mindset, deep industry familiarity, and a passion for supporting the local hospitality ecosystem.

Responsibilities

  • Account Retention & Revenue Growth: Build and maintain strategic relationships with restaurant leadership to achieve quarterly retention and upsell targets, including contract renewals and premium marketing tool adoption.

  • Consultative Business Reviews: Conduct ongoing, data-driven business reviews and executive meetings to deliver industry insights, benchmark performance, and optimize reservation flows.

  • Cross-Functional Customer Advocacy: Serve as the primary point of escalation for restaurant partners, collaborating with internal product and support teams to resolve issues and inform feature enhancements.

  • Marketing & Promotional Execution: Partner with the marketing team to design, execute, and evaluate custom marketing initiatives that drive program participation and diner engagement.

  • Operational Excellence & Tracking: Maintain accurate account records, interaction logs, and activity metrics in Salesforce to inform territory strategy and account health forecasting.

  • Industry Education & Thought Leadership: Educate operators on emerging hospitality trends and economic drivers, empowering clients to make data-informed operational decisions.

Minimum Qualifications

  • 3+ years of account management, customer success, or operational management experience within the restaurant or hospitality industry.

  • Residency in the Las Vegas metropolitan area with a valid driver's license and reliable transportation for local field visits.

  • Demonstrated expertise in restaurant operations and financial analysis, including the ability to interpret P&L statements and business metrics.

  • Proven track record of using a consultative approach to manage client relationships, handle objections, and achieve retention or growth goals.

  • Strong written and oral communication skills, with experience preparing and delivering data-driven presentations to group audiences.

Work Environment & Flexibility

At OpenTable, we pride ourselves on fostering a global and dynamic work environment. As a team member with us, you will benefit from a schedule tailored to accommodate a global workforce operating across multiple time zones. While the majority of your responsibilities may align with conventional business hours, there will be instances where you are expected to manage communications - via calls, Slack messages, or emails - outside of regular working hours to effectively collaborate with international colleagues, respond to restaurant partners, and/or address urgent matters. OpenTable will always abide by and consider local laws and regulations.
